One of the most wholesome families in America’s reality TV landscape, the Duggars, have been the subject of several shows over the years. 19 Kids and Counting followed Michelle and Jim Bob Duggar and their 19 children.
One of the recent docuseries, Shiny Happy People (Season 1), reveals a very different side of the family. With the growing popularity of documentaries in recent years on streaming platforms, is this limited series available to stream on Netflix?

Although Netflix has an interesting lineup of documentaries, Shiny Happy People - Duggar Family Secrets is not available to stream on the platform. The series had earlier premiered on Amazon Prime on June 2, 2023, and it is now available to stream on Prime. The series follows the controversies around the family, their eldest son, Josh Duggar, and their link with the organisation, Institute for Basic Life Principles.
Directed by Olivia Crist and Julia Willoughby Nason, the series has four episodes featuring interviews and footage. With each episode nearly 45 minutes long, the series gives a detailed look into the family. As for the Shiny Happy People, the series returned for a second season in 2025, focusing on Ron Luce's Teen Mania.

What is the new documentary trending on Netflix?
A Friend, a Murderer, released on March 5, 2026, had quickly found a spot on the trending lists across several countries, including Denmark and Sweden. It had even reached the top 5 in Netflix’s global TV shows ranking, according to FlixPatrol. The series follows three friends who realize that someone they trust deeply is not who he appears to be.

Soon, they discover that their close friend is a convicted murderer and kidnapper. Based on a true story set in a rural Danish town, the 3-part crime docuseries explores his crimes while also showing the emotional impact of his betrayal on those closest to him.
